Cured my donk's white line disease
My mini donkey came down with white line disease in 2 hooves. My farrier recommended a treatment that required the donkey to wear boots with medication in it. The donkey wouldn't allow me to put the boots on for the medicine. I found this treatment & it worked well and was so much easier to use . It comes in a tube which you have to knead to mix the medication. The medication is a very thick blue coarse sandlike mixture that is somewhat difficult to squeeze out of the tube. There are multiple treatments in each tube. My only recommendation to the manufacturers of this product is to change the packaging to facilitate ease of application. This could be done by making the spout of the tube wider or putting the medicine in a container with a lid and supplying a tongue depressor type implement so the user could apply that way. But all in all, I am pleased with this product as it did what it was supposed to do, was reasonable in price, and much easier to use than trying to soak hooves.

It works! Farrier approved.
This is the second time I have purchased this product. It works amazingly! My horse has had a very stubborn case of White Line Disease. His pasture and the area we live is not conducive to healthy hooves. I had purchased 5 or more different products to help correct the White Line, but they either didn't do a thing, or the difference was negligible. The first week that I received B Gone, I applied it once a day for 3 days. After that I applied it once every 2-3 days for 2 weeks, then moved to once a week. After the second application I saw a noticeable difference! Now the White Line is nearly gone after a couple months. I missed a few weeks during a busy season or it would be gone by now. Even after not applying it for a few weeks, I could still see the blue tint of the product in his hoof wall when cleaning my horse's feet. IT WORKS! The thickness is perfect. I sqeeze some onto his hoof wall and rub it in with my finger. It has never irritated my skin, smells pleasant, and easy to clean off. I love the application syringe! It makes it so simple to apply with one hand. I will never go without this product again. It will be instrumental in preventing White Line once it is gone. I highly recommend it! All 3 of my horses have been battling white line disease since moving to the deep south with clay marshy soil, and since we haven't set up a barn yet where we can get them out of the mud while the days and days of heavy unrelenting rain makes their pasture to pure gross mush, I have not been able to get the white line under control. I've tried white lightning, diluted bleach, thrush buster, kopertox, vinager, thrush buster, and well pretty much everything. While their hooves weren't getting "worse" they were not getting better either. And having a 2 yr old gelding who HATED soaking I was looking for something to really knock it out with a lot less work for both the horses and myself. 1.5 tubes later and instead of cleaning daily I'm only cleaning and applying some b-gone once a week, and they are all 3 are almost completely white line free!! I could see so much of a difference between one week to the next, and the blue paste was still in their white line grooves after huge storms and sloppy mud for days! My appy who had it the worst now has only a tiny part on his front hooves that at the rate its leaving I'm almost certain will be gone by next application.

Got rid of a horrible case of white line
Because I was taking care of my mother, I did not see my gelding for a while. My ferrier informed me when he came to trim that my gelding had a bad case of white line disease that went half way up his hoof. I was devastated since I felt I had neglected him. I tried this product and boy, the next trim, my ferrier said that the white line issue was gone- It literally took about 2 weeks or less. It is fairly simple to use, however, the syringe was a bit hard for me to push the medication out, so I squeezed some of the BGone into a smaller syringe to get the medicine up into the inside of the hoof wall. It was easier for me to squeeze and the tip of the smaller syringe was able to get a bit further into the hoof wall crack caused by the white line. I highly recommend this product.
